Abstract Obesity is characterized by the excess of body fat and, therefore, may cause musculoskeletal alterations that can negatively influence the tendons. Such overweight-influenced alterations are exercise sensitive though. Morphological and biochemical alterations were reported in the calcaneal tendon of mice submitted to a lipid-rich diets along with practicing exercises, with the following groups: normal diet without exercise (ND), normal diet with exercise (NDex), lipid-rich diet without exercise (LD), lipid-rich diet without exercise (LDex). The calcaneal tendons were removed and subjected to histological and biochemical analysis. Muscular atrophy is a progressive degeneration characterized by muscular proteolysis, loss of mass and decrease in fiber area. Tendon rupture induces muscular atrophy due to an intrinsic functional connection. Local inhibition of nitric oxide synthase (NOS) by Nω-nitro-L-arginine methyl ester (L-NAME) accelerates tendon histological recovery and induces functional improvement. Here we evaluate the effects of such local nitrergic inhibition on the pattern of soleus muscle regeneration after tenotomy. Adult male Wistar rats (240 to 280 g) were divided into four experimental groups: control (n=4), tenotomized (n=6), vehicle (n=6), and L-NAME (n=6). Twenty Thoroughbred racehorses were ultrasonographically evaluated to determine the relation between normal values of the cross-sectional area (CSA) of the right and left forelimbs superficial digital flexor tendons (SDFT) in the metacarpal region for trained and untrained Thoroughbreds racehorses. Ultrasonography revealed that CSA at 26cm distal to the accessory carpal bone is larger than other proximal levels, for either left or right forelimbs. In addition, the CSA at 2, 4, 6, 8, 10, 12 and 14cm distal to the accessory carpal bone of the left forelimb are larger (P<0.05) for trained horses when compared with untrained horses. The aim of this study was to evaluate the effect of snake venom derived fibrin glue on the healing of the deep digital flexor tendon, during three periods. The tendon of the 2nd digit of 30 thoracic limbs of dogs was partially sectioned for glue application. Biopsies were performed 7, 15, and 30 days post surgery for the clinical and morphological study of tendons. Analysis of the results showed that 73.3% of the tendons showed stump retraction and 16.6% moderate to excessive adherence, which affected sliding. There was a significant difference in the number of inflammatory cells among the three studied periods, being the highest on day 15. The aim of this study was to evaluate the effect of snake venom derived fibrin glue on the strength oftendon healing in dogs. The deep digital flexor tendon of the 5th digit of 24 thoracic limbs was partially sectioned for adhesive application. On the 7th, 15th, and 30th postoperative day tendons segments were removed for the clinical and biomechanical study. Results indicated that 62.5% of the tendons showed stump retraction and 20.8% moderate to excessive adherence, which affected gliding. The biomechanical evaluation showed that, over time, tendon healing gained progressive resistance for maximum traction and permanent deformations with satisfactory results on the 15th day for rigidity and resilience compared to the other two studied periods.
